Set against the backdrop of the Philippines Government’s crackdown on illegal drugs, a SWAT-led police force launches an operation to arrest Abel, one of the biggest drug lords in Manila. Police Officer Espino and Elijah, a small-time pusher turned informant, provide the intelligence for the operation, which quickly escalates into a violent and heavily-armed confrontation in the slums between the SWAT and Abel’s gang. Before the investigators arrive at the crime scene, Espino and Elijah walk off with Abel’s backpack full of money and methamphetamine. This gesture of survival for one and corruption for the other will soon set off a dangerous series of events, both of them risking their reputations, families and lives in the process. The film has won the Prize of the Jury at the Beaune International Thriller Film Festival 2019, and the Special Jury Prize and the Special Mention SIGNIS Award at the San Sebastián International Film Festival 2018.

Brillante Mendoza is one of the most important Filipino filmmakers working today. He won the Golden Leopard at Locarno Film Festival with his debut film, “Masahista” (2005). His works have competed in major film festivals such as Berlinale, Venice and Cannes, picking up Best Director (for “Kinatay”, 2009) and Best Actress (for “Ma’ Rosa”, 2016) at Cannes.
